Pesticide microencapsulation: Key to modern pest control

Pesticide microencapsulation is a technique where active ingredients are enclosed in microscopic capsules. This prevents premature degradation, controls release, and ensures effective pest targeting. Microencapsulated pesticides enhance crop protection efficiency while minimizing chemical exposure.

Encapsulated pesticide formulations provide long-lasting protection, reduce environmental contamination, and lower application frequency. Controlled release pesticides gradually release active compounds, maintaining effective concentrations over time.

Nano-encapsulated pesticides improve bioavailability and precision, targeting pests more efficiently and minimizing collateral damage to non-target organisms. Adoption of pesticide microencapsulation supports sustainable agriculture, lowers costs, and meets regulatory standards for residue management.

Farmers using microencapsulation benefit from higher crop yields, reduced chemical usage, and improved environmental safety, making it a crucial technology in modern agriculture.


FAQs

1. What is pesticide microencapsulation?
A method of enclosing pesticide ingredients in microcapsules for controlled release and enhanced efficiency.

2. How do microencapsulated pesticides improve pest control?
They protect the active ingredient and provide prolonged activity, reducing the need for repeated applications.

3. What are encapsulated pesticide formulations?
Formulations that enclose pesticides in microcapsules to ensure stability, control, and safety.

4. How do controlled release pesticides benefit farmers?
They reduce chemical usage, labor costs, and environmental contamination.

5. What are nano-encapsulated pesticides?
Pesticides using nanoscale carriers for enhanced precision, bioavailability, and targeted pest control.
